Choosing the Perfect Goat Cheese

The key to a great goat cheese pizza lies in selecting the right type of goat cheese. Look for fresh goat cheese that is soft and spreadable, with a creamy texture and a slightly tangy flavor. Avoid aged goat cheese, as it has a stronger, more pungent taste that may overpower the other ingredients.

Selecting the Best Pizza Crust

The choice of pizza crust is equally important. You can use a pre-made pizza crust from the grocery store, or make your own from scratch. If you opt for a pre-made crust, be sure to choose a thin crust that will allow the goat cheese and toppings to shine through. For a homemade crust, use a simple dough recipe that calls for flour, water, yeast, and a pinch of salt.

Preparing the Pizza

Once you have your goat cheese and pizza crust ready, it’s time to assemble the pizza.

1. Spread the Goat Cheese: Spread a generous layer of goat cheese evenly over the pizza crust, leaving a small border around the edges.
2. Add Toppings: Choose your favorite toppings to complement the goat cheese. Popular options include caramelized onions, mushrooms, spinach, and bacon.
3. Drizzle with Olive Oil: Drizzle a small amount of olive oil over the toppings to help them brown and crisp in the oven.
4. Bake: Bake the pizza in a preheated oven at 450-500°F (230-260°C) for 10-15 minutes, or until the crust is golden brown and the cheese is melted and bubbly.

Tips for the Best Goat Cheese Pizza

  • Use fresh, high-quality ingredients: The quality of your ingredients will greatly impact the flavor of your pizza.
  • Don’t overload the pizza: Too many toppings can weigh down the crust and prevent it from cooking evenly.
  • Bake the pizza on a hot stone: A hot stone will help create a crispy crust and prevent the pizza from becoming soggy.
  • Let the pizza rest before slicing: This will allow the cheese to set and prevent it from sliding off the crust.

Quick Answers to Your FAQs

Q: Can I use goat cheese that is not fresh?
A: Yes, you can use aged goat cheese, but keep in mind that it will have a stronger flavor.

Q: Can I make my own pizza dough?
A: Yes, you can use a simple pizza dough recipe that calls for flour, water, yeast, and a pinch of salt.

Q: What are some other toppings that go well with goat cheese?
A: Some other toppings that complement goat cheese include roasted peppers, artichokes, and sun-dried tomatoes.
